Holyrood Manor Long Term Care
604-467-8831
22710 Holyrood Ave
Maple Ridge
BC V2X 3E6
Holyrood Manor Long Term Care QR Card
Rate & Review Holyrood Manor Long Term Care
Update Holyrood Manor Long Term Care and add logo, business hours, images and more.